// <iostream> is unique among the C++ stream headers: on libstdc++ it emits a
|
||
|
|
// reference to std::ios_base_library_init in every TU that includes it, which
|
||
|
|
// forces libstdc++'s globals_io.o into the link. That object's
|
||
|
|
// _GLOBAL__sub_I.00090_globals_io.cc initializer constructs cin/cout/cerr/clog
|
||
|
|
// (and the wchar_t variants) before main, dragging the full std::locale facet
|
||
|
|
// set (ctype/numpunct/moneypunct/timepunct/messages for char and wchar_t) into
|
||
|
|
// every Bun process startup. Bun never touches C++ iostreams at runtime.
|
||
|
|
//
|
||
|
|
// <ostream>, <istream>, <sstream> and <fstream> are fine: they declare the
|
||
|
|
// stream types but do not emit the static Init object. If you need to print to
|
||
|
|
// stderr from C++, use fputs/fprintf.
|
||
|
|
//
|
||
|
|
// The upstream source of the original leak was the vendored simdutf header
|
||
|
|
// inside WebKit (Source/WTF/wtf/simdutf/simdutf_impl.h); that is handled by
|
||
|
|
// the WebKit pin. This test guards Bun's own compiled C++ so the initializer
|
||
|
|
// cannot creep back in through packages/ or src/.
